
Trading forex (foreign exchange) with XM is a popular choice for many traders, as XM offers access to a wide range of currency pairs and provides various trading tools and platforms. Here are the steps to start trading forex with XM:
-
Account Registration:
- Click on the "Open an Account" or "Register" button.
- Provide your personal information, including name, email address, phone number, and residential address.
- Select the type of forex trading account you want to open (e.g., Micro, Standard, XM Ultra Low, etc.).
-
Account Verification:
- XM may require you to submit identification documents for verification purposes. These typically include a copy of your passport or ID card and a recent utility bill or bank statement.
-
Deposit Funds:
- After your account is verified, you need to deposit funds into your forex trading account. XM offers various deposit options, including credit/debit cards, bank transfers, and e-wallets like Neteller and Skrill.
-
Choose a Forex Trading Platform:
- XM provides access to popular forex trading platforms such as M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5). Select the platform that suits your trading preferences.
-
Download and Install the Forex Trading Platform:
- If you choose MT4 or MT5, download and install the platform on your computer or mobile device.
-
Login and Start Forex Trading:
- Use your XM account credentials to log in to the forex trading platform.
- Familiarize yourself with the platform's features and tools, especially those relevant to forex trading.
-
Select Forex Currency Pairs:
-
Analyze and Place Forex Orders:
- Conduct technical and fundamental analysis to make informed trading decisions.
- Place forex orders, such as market orders, limit orders, and stop orders, based on your analysis and trading strategy.
-
Implement Risk Management:
- Set stop-loss and take-profit orders to manage your risk and protect your capital. This is crucial in forex trading due to the high volatility of the market.
-
Monitor Your Forex Positions:
- Keep a close eye on your open forex positions and market conditions. Monitor news and economic events that can impact currency prices.
-
Learn and Improve:
- Forex trading is a skill that requires continuous learning. Practice and refine your strategies using demo accounts before risking real capital.
-
Withdraw Profits:
- If you make profits, you can withdraw them to your bank account or e-wallet by requesting a withdrawal through your XM account.
Remember that forex trading involves substantial risks, including the potential loss of your entire capital. It's essential to have a well-defined trading plan, a solid risk management strategy, and a thorough understanding of the forex market before you start trading with XM or any other forex broker. Trading responsibly and within your financial means is crucial to long-term success in forex trading.
